Output cd4ab2d84a50876520acc163f6c20fca6233779421319e2fe37160c5d335d182:12

value
32527215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d2c3fd37965e114500cb84a407b23c0b1faf28 OP_EQUAL
address
M8LfRSsgCDZZevoeW1RyrrvEhJJ4U63MsL
transaction
cd4ab2d84a50876520acc163f6c20fca6233779421319e2fe37160c5d335d182
spent
true